Construction of the long-delayed Nawla–Angampitiya Bridge, halted midway due to the economic crisis and other factors, has resumed under the State Development & Construction Corporation (SD&CC) and is now in its final stages.
The project is expected to be completed and opened to the public by the end of this year.
Deputy Minister of Transport and Highways Prasanna Gunasena inspected the bridge, accompanied by SD&CC Chairman and other officials. (Newswire)
